The Travel Agent Next Door (TTAND) celebrated its Top Achievers with a trip to South Africa that included an African Safari hosted by G Adventures.

The 40-person group was escorted by David Green, G Adventures Managing Director, TTAND CEO Flemming Friisdahl, TTAND VP Rhonda Stanley, TTAND VP Agent Experience Penny Martin, and Larissa Bureau, Special Projects, TTAND. Suppliers Celebrity Cruises, Royal Caribbean, Globus, Regent Seven Seas, and AmaWaterways also attended.

“This was an absolutely amazing trip for our top achievers,” said Flemming Friisdahl, TTAND CEO. “G Adventures pulled out all the stops for this one and it was a truly unique experience for our TTAND agents.”

The group embarked on a journey through South Africa, starting with a visit to Johannesburg and Soweto, followed by exploration in Cape Town, including Table Mountain and wineries, before concluding with optional excursions to Victoria Falls.

"Thank you to The Travel Agent Next Door for choosing G Adventures to celebrate your Top Achievers in South Africa during your special 10th anniversary year celebrations. For many this was a bucket list experience, their first safari, their first visit to Victoria Falls, one of the natural wonders of the world and a new continent to explore,” said David Green, Managing Director Canada, G Adventures.

He added: “ The emotions were running high as we experienced community tourism in action, learning through the eyes of our local CEO's and guides who told their stories with passion and joy. 100% of the costs associated with the tour stayed in the local communities that we visited, and it's fair to say that we all came back enriched from the experience. Thank you TTAND for your continued support, and we look forward to celebrating with you all in Jordan for your 10th Anniversary conference."
